WebFeb 7, 2024 · How long it takes Nexium to work may vary from person to person. It may take up to 4 days for you to feel symptom relief. But it may start working in as little as 1 day for some people. It’s important to only take Nexium for as long as your healthcare provider recommends. WebAntacids work quickly, but effects may last up to 2 hours per dose. Proton Pump Inhibitors (PPIs) PPIs, like Nexium® and Prilosec®, work by shutting down pumps that release acid into your stomach. PPIs require a 14-day regimen, are intended to treat frequent heartburn, and are not intended for immediate relief. In fact, PPIs may take 1-4 days ... WebApr 1, 2024 · Esomeprazole is also used with antibiotics (eg, amoxicillin, clarithromycin) to treat ulcers that are caused by the H. pylori bacteria. This medicine is also used to prevent stomach ulcers and stomach irritation in patients taking NSAIDs (eg, aspirin, ibuprofen) for long periods of time. Esomeprazole is a proton pump inhibitor (PPI).

WebUses. Esomeprazole is used to treat certain stomach and esophagus problems (such as acid reflux, ulcers). It works by decreasing the amount of acid your stomach makes. There is a possible risk of diarrhea related to Clostridioides difficile ( C. diff) with PPI use. Use of PPIs is also linked to a high risk of repeat C. diff infections.
